First, it is important to understand that SHARK has a great deal of respect for good law enforcement personnel. Society could not get along without these dedicated men and women.

Because of the importance of GOOD law enforcement, we find those who abuse their authority to be have an extremely corrosive effect on society.

What happens when the Chief of Police of Altamont and the Sheriff of Effingham County in Illinois sponsor the Illinois High School Rodeo Association? These supposed law enforcement professionals obstruct and harass Approved Illinois Humane Investigators who are simply trying to document a rodeo and a rodeo producer with a history of abuse.
